What services do architectural designers in Tulse Hill offer ?

An architectural designer can translate your dreams into buildable, feasible realities. From structural layouts and building regulations to aesthetic details and spatial functionality, it’s always best to hire an architectural designer in Tulse Hill and let a professional bring your home renovation vision to life!

Architectural designers can offer a wide range of services:

  • Conducting surveys and feasibility studies
  • Creating designs and detailed planning drawings
  • Assisting with planning applications
  • Helping source contractors
  • Managing and administering projects

Average costs of architectural design services in Tulse Hill

The cost of hiring an architectural designer in Tulse Hill can vary quite a bit depending on the size and scope of your project, from simple home extensions to full property redesigns.

Most architectural designers tend to charge in one of three main ways:

  • A flat fee for a set of plans or drawings, which can range from around £1,000 to £5,000 depending on complexity.

  • A fixed fee per project, which often falls between £2,500 and £7,000 for typical residential extensions or renovations.

  • A percentage of the total construction cost, usually between 7% and 15%, with the national average around 10-11%.

Hourly Tulse Hill architect rates are also common for smaller jobs or consultancy, generally between £50 and £100 per hour.

FAQ: Common questions about architectural designers in Tulse Hill

Can an architectural designer help with planning applications in Tulse Hill?

Yes, many architectural designers guide clients through the entire planning permission process, liaise with Tulse Hill’s council, and prepare all necessary documents to improve your chances of approval.

How long does it typically take for an architectural designer in Tulse Hill to get planning permission?

The timeline varies by project and local council workload but usually ranges from 6 to 12 weeks. A local architectural designer in Tulse Hill can provide a more accurate estimate based on recent projects in the area.

Can an architectural designer in Tulse Hill work within conservation or heritage restrictions?

In some areas, conservation areas or listed buildings may impose specific design restrictions. An architectural designer in Tulse Hill should be familiar with these regulations and can guide you on how to work within them while still achieving your design goals.
